My car had brakes changed before i took delivery, the dudes didnt reset the service lights on the brakes.

I tried today and now the will not reset.
same problem as this poor soul.
[video=youtube]

Any ideas how to fix it?
 

Midas335i

New member
You have to fit a new wear sensor then reset it. The sensor wears with the brake pads, so they have to be replaced then reset the indicator.

Lots of guys don't change the sensor, one for the front and one for the rear :thumbs:

Had the same issue

One of the front sensor cable was rubbing against the rim and got cut with wear
The dealer just replced pads and dint put yhe cable right
Replaced it and all is good
